Ball Mill
According to the ratio of cylinder length (L) to diameter (D), the ball mill can be divided into short cylinder ball mill, L/D ≤ 1; long barrel ball mill, L/D ≥ 1–1.5 or even 2–3; and tube mill, L/D ≥ 3–5. According to the cylinder shape of the ball mill, it can be divided into cylindrical ball mill and cone ball mill.

Schematic diagram of double roll crusher. ... In early days a ball mill was used in conjunction with a tube mill. The ball mill was short with a large diameter (L/D = 0.5) and very large size grinding media. The mill was fitted with peripheral screens that passed coarsely ground material to the tube mill, which was long with a smaller diameter ...

Vertical Roller Mill Operation in Cement Plant
The vertical roller mill (VRM) is a type of grinding machine for raw material processing and cement grinding in the cement manufacturing process.In recent years, the VRM cement mill has been equipped in more and more cement plants around the world because of its features like high energy efficiency, low pollutant generation, small floor area, etc..
